What this 1.5kW Zener TVS protects against
The 1.5KE39A_R2_00001: With a peak pulse power rating of 1500 W (10/1000 µs waveform) and a clamping voltage of 53.9 V at 28 A, this part absorbs high-energy surges — think load-dump events, inductive kickback, or lightning-induced transients on a 24 V or 33 V bus. The 33.3 V reverse standoff voltage means the diode stays out of the circuit below that level; it only starts conducting when the line exceeds the 37.1 V minimum breakdown threshold.
Package and board-fit for a through-hole design
Housed in a DO-201AE axial-lead package, this TVS diode is a through-hole part — it inserts into a plated through-hole on the PCB and is wave-soldered or hand-soldered. Operating temperature spans -65 °C to 175 °C junction, covering military and industrial thermal extremes — a relay driver or motor controller in a hot cabinet sees no derating concern.
Lifecycle status and how to source it now
Panjit lists the 1.5KE39A_R2_00001 as obsolete — the manufacturer no longer produces it as a standard catalogue item. No official successor order code is recorded from Panjit; the closest functional replacement is another 1.5KE39A from a different brand or a current-production TVS with the same 33.3 V standoff and DO-201AE package, but pin-compatibility must be verified per the BOM position.
